On 06/08/19 11:01, Marc Zyngier wrote:
> GICv3.1 allows up to 80 PPIs (16 legaci PPIs and 64 Extended PPIs),
> meaning we can't just leave the old 16 hardcoded everywhere.
>
> We also need to add the infrastructure to discover the number of PPIs
> on a per redistributor basis, although we still pretend there is only
> 16 of them for now.
>
> No functional change.

> -void gic_cpu_config(void __iomem *base, void (*sync_access)(void))
> +void gic_cpu_config(void __iomem *base, int nr, void (*sync_access)(void))
> {
> int i;
>
> /*
> * Deal with the banked PPI and SGI interrupts - disable all
> - * PPI interrupts, ensure all SGI interrupts are enabled.
> - * Make sure everything is deactivated.
> + * private interrupts. Make sure everything is deactivated.
> */
> - writel_relaxed(GICD_INT_EN_CLR_X32, base + GIC_DIST_ACTIVE_CLEAR);
> - writel_relaxed(GICD_INT_EN_CLR_PPI, base + GIC_DIST_ENABLE_CLEAR);
> - writel_relaxed(GICD_INT_EN_SET_SGI, base + GIC_DIST_ENABLE_SET);
> + for (i = 0; i < nr; i += 32) {

You added "nr" as argument but if "nr" isn't a multiple of 32 weird
things might happen, no?

It would be worth specifying that somewhere, and checking it with a WARN().

Maybe it might be worth reducing the granularity to manipulating 16 irqs
since there are 16 SGI + 16 PPI + 64 EPPI, but that might not be very
useful right now.
